首页 诗词 字典 板报 句子 名言 友答 励志 学校 网站地图
当前位置: 首页 > 教程频道 > .NET > C# >

请教同一数据库,不同表内不同列值比较大小,如何实现

2012-07-29 
请问同一数据库,不同表内不同列值比较大小,怎么实现?现在有两个表1,表2.他们通过‘id’列关联。表2的‘dose’列

请问同一数据库,不同表内不同列值比较大小,怎么实现?
现在有两个表1,表2.他们通过‘id’列关联。表2的‘dose’列的每一行的数值要跟表1‘size’列相对应id行的数值进行比较大小。怎么个比较法?

若dose>size的值,则将dose所对应的id在datagridview控件中显示出来!

数据库是mysql

求大牛解答

[解决办法]
这个用SQL写过存储过程就能实现。如果非要用.NET实现,那就通过inner join把两个字段取出来再比较。

热点排行